Downtown Languages looking for Program & Volunteer Coordinator: deadline March 6
Downtown Languages is pleased to announce a new part-time position for Program & Volunteer Coordinator that will primarily work with the Downtown Languages’ Latino Family Literacy program and the Latino Youth Leadership summer program.
The deadline for priority consideration is MARCH 6TH.
From the job description: “Downtown Languages (DTL) is seeking a part-time Bilingual (English/Spanish) Program and Volunteer Coordinator to be the primary administrator for our Pilas Family Literacy and Pasos al Futuro programs. The Coordinator will work with other administration staff, instructors, and community partners to ensure successful delivery of these two programs. Both programs require a great deal of coordination and managing of details.”
